Synthesis and characterization of Rh(PVP) nanoparticles studied by XPS and NEXAFS
T. Ashida,K. Miura,T. Nomoto,Shinya Yagi,H. Sumida,G. Kutluk,Kazuo Soda,Hirofumi Namatame,Masaki Taniguchi +8 more
TL;DR: Rhodium nanoparticles were synthesized by the reduction of Rh3+ ion in ethanol solvent with use of the polyvinylpyrrolidone (PVP) of various molecular weights and the solvent of different volume ratios of water to ethanol as mentioned in this paper.

Spectroscopic Study on the Reaction of L-Cysteine in Rh(PVP) Nanoparticle Colloidal Solution
TL;DR: The details of cystine synthesis reaction are revealed using S-K edge NEXAFS technique and there are four reactions, which are the adsorption of L-cysteine on Rh nanoparticle surface, the L- Cysteine decomposition to cysteine thiolate, the formation of the complex structure similar to (NH4)3[RhCl6] and the synthesis of Cystine molecule on Rh Nanocolloidal solution.
